Everton vs Bournemouth Head-to-Head and Key Numbers
This will, of course, be Bournemouth's first visit to the Hill-Dickinson Stadium. Earlier in the season, Everton beat the Cherries 0-1, although it was their first win over them since October 2023.
Everton will come into this match buoyed by some strong recent results, most notably their late win over Fulham on Saturday. The Toffees are now unbeaten in four league matches.
Bournemouth were able to secure a point this Saturday against high flying Aston Villa, although they arguably deserved to win the match. The draw means they are also unbeaten in four coming into this one.
Everton have become masters of the late goal in recent weeks. Not only have their last five league goals come in the second half, but their last four have come past the 75 minute mark.
Bournemouth's away record this season leaves a lot to be desired. They have only won two of their 12 away matches this season, beating Tottenham back in August and Wolves in late January. They have also lost five games on the road, and have conceded 30 of their 44 goals away.
Everton vs Bournemouth Prediction
Given Bournemouth's poor away record this season and Everton's good run of form in recent weeks, this game looks like a good one for David Moyes' side right now.
However, Bournemouth did look very dangerous against Aston Villa, with attackers like Rayan and Eli Kroupi offering a big threat. It will be difficult for Everton to keep them quiet.
With that said, Bournemouth's high-energy style may be hard to replicate with such a short period of time between games, and so the prediction is a home win - with Everton likely picking off the Cherries on the break.
Prediction: Everton 1-0 Bournemouth
